5.7.2. Configuring an Absolute Encoder
Select the absolute encoder’s application with the following parameter.

Either “0” or “1” in the following table must be set in order to enable
the absolute encoder.
Pn002.2 Setting Result
0 Uses the absolute encoder as an absolute encoder.
1 Uses the absolute encoder as an incremental encoder.
The following parameter is used to periodically clear the encoder’s
counter (return the setting to 0) after a designated ratio of motor to load
axis revolutions. This function is called the multi-turn limit.
Note: The term Multi-turn Limit refers to the highest number of rotations the encoder’s counter will display
before returning the counter to 0.

• When Pn205 is set to the default (65535), multi-turn data varies in
the range of −32768 to +32767.
• With any other Pn205 value entered, data varies from 0 to the set
value.
Note: To activate reassignment of this value, the user must first enter the change to the parameter, and then
cycle (turn OFF and then turn ON) the power.
Since the encoder’s multi-turn limit value is set by default to 65535, the
following alarm occurs if the servo amplifier’s power supply is cycled
(turned OFF and ON) after changing parameter Pn205:
